Dried apricots: stable market

November 5, 2024 at 12:12 PM , Der AUDITOR
Play report as audio

MALATYA. Prices for Turkish dried apricots are currently holding steady. However, growers are urgently advised to look into the right pruning techniques for their trees in order to maximise yields. Exports are still going well.

Calm market situation

On the Turkish dried apricot market, both commodity and export prices remain at the same level as last week. The markets are largely calm and demand is moderate but stable. No 1 and no 2 dried apricots currently cost TRY 140-150/kg, while export prices for no 2 are at USD 4,900/mt FOB Mersin.
